Health as a biopsychosocial model The biopsychosocial approach to health is a holistic approach to health care. It recognizes the vital importance of psychological, biological and social factors in the development or progression of disease or illness. Social and psychological factors can cause an increased risk of depression due to genetics. This is also true for strategies to cope. The biopsychosocial model recognizes that many health problems are preventable or treatable by taking care of the biological, social and psychological factors that impact health. It allows you to more effectively treat and manage health problems. However, it has some limitations. Many critics claim it's impossible to treat health issues just on the physical level. Research in health is now increasingly using the biopsychosocial model. Although it has its flaws it is a great model for multidisciplinary analysis. It is particularly helpful in understanding the intricate interplay between psychological, biological and social aspects. In order to be able to understand the complex interactions among these variables, the biopsychosocial concepts were utilized in an overview of the scope. The biopsychosocial model is similar to the socioecological model. The primary difference between these models is that the biopsychosocial method emphasizes the interdisciplinarity and ability to examine multiple factors simultaneously. Programs to promote wellness at work Employers and their employees are faced with increasing health care costs. Employee wellness programs at work can help to counter this trend. They provide information on healthier lifestyle choices for employees via a variety of media. They could include video or printed materials, health-related tests and bulletin boards. Participants can also be given incentives from employers. Employees with disabilities must be able to take advantage of health and wellness programs at work that are flexible enough to accommodate their needs. Some programs offer transportation, child care and others help with nutrition and access to healthy choices for food. However, workers should not be punished for not meeting goals, and programs must be designed to enhance the overall health of employees and their overall well-being. Studies have previously shown that programs to improve workplace health have positive results on the investments. This is evident by reduced health expenditure and absences. However, these results can be influenced by selection biases as well as limitations in the methodological approach. If these studies are based in randomized controlled trials it is more likely that their findings are reliable. The EEOC, the federal agency charged with enforcing GINA/ADA, has recently issued regulations on workplace wellness programs. These regulations are designed to safeguard workers from discrimination and to encourage employers to offer healthier options to employees.
